    • They are basically the same app but are different version numbers. There are some differences, like the App store version requires certain things like data file location etc because of sandboxing.

    The Mac App Store is a free upgrade to 1Password 4 should you buy now.

    And

    The Agile site is a free upgrade to 1Password 4 for user's whom purchased 1Password 3 after Jan 1 2013.

    The Mac App Store doesn't have user requirements, you can install on any Mac you feel comfortable having your Apple ID tied to. Its a easier place for folks whom don't feel like checking for updates and downloading and installing like would be experienced with the agile store version.

  • Hi guys,

    Henry is correct. iCloud sync will only be available for the 1Password app at the Mac App Store, the website version will remain with Dropbox only for now in addition to the USB sync tool we're working on.
